Housing Stock in Leżajsk Municipality 2020
In 2020, Leżajsk municipality ranked 351 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 346 units +6.52% between 2015-2020, reaching 5,649.
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in top 40% for housing growth rate. Within Leżajski county, ranked 2 of 5 municipalities. In Subcarpathian province, ranked 22.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Leżajski county municipalities within Subcarpathian province.
